[QUOTE="Robbo, post: 521529, member: 256551"] Hi, The largest choice of Free To Air Spanish channels is on Hispasat at 30 degrees West. Have a look here:- _http://www.flysat.com/tv-sp.php To point a dish at Hispasat the dish will need to point approximately 30 degrees west of south. To get the dish elevation angle required use _www.dishpointer.com. You may get away with a Zone 1 minidish for Hispasat, personally I would go with a zone 2 just to make sure. Either way the LNB may need to me modified slightly to get the Skew right for a western satellite.
